Abstract

A video distribution apparatus that distributes video to a receiving apparatus by communication or broadcasting, comprising: a delivery member; associating a plurality of thumbnail data generated from the video data and a plurality of text data generated from subtitle data accompanying the video on a time axis to be previously distributed to the receiving apparatus; a request receiving section that receives a video distribution request including time information of text data selected from the text data displayed in the receiving apparatus from the receiving apparatus; a video distribution unit that, when the distribution request is received, specifies a distribution start position of the video data based on the time information, and distributes the video data to be distributed; and a processing unit configured to perform a predetermined process on the specified portion of the video data distributed by the video distribution unit.

背景技术 Background technique

作为电视广播被广播的节目的数据中,包含视频数据和语音数据。此外,被广播的节目数据中,由于作为视频数据而被包含,因此有时包含在用户侧不能选择是否要显示的字幕(节目名或角色等的介绍,或者,海外作品中的日文字幕)。此外,被广播的节目数据中,有时包含在用户侧能够选择是否使其显示的字幕数据。这样的可选择的字幕数据一般被称为封闭字幕(ClosedCaption),主要开发用于听力障碍者,不仅像海外作品中的日语字幕那样包括出演者的对话,还包括例如BGM或效果音等的说明。  Data of programs broadcast as television broadcasts include video data and audio data. In addition, since the program data to be broadcast is included as video data, subtitles (introduction of program titles, characters, etc., or Japanese subtitles in overseas works) may be included which cannot be selected on the user side. In addition, subtitle data which can be selected on the user side to be displayed may be included in broadcast program data. Such optional subtitle data is generally called Closed Caption (Closed Caption), which is mainly developed for the hearing-impaired. It includes not only the dialogue of the actors like the Japanese subtitles in overseas works, but also includes explanations such as BGM and sound effects. . the

例如,在NTSC(美国国家电视标准委员会:National Television SystemCommittee)方式的模拟的地面波广播中,视频信号中使用525条的扫描线,该525条中,各个场(field)(由2个场构成1个帧)的最初的21条分配用于被称为VBI(Vertical Blanking Interval:垂直消隐期间)的用于开始扫描的间隔(interval)。封闭字幕是通过对各个场的VBI中的第21条上复用字符码而被传输的。然后,使用各个场将2种字符组每秒传输约60字符。  For example, in NTSC (National Television Standards Committee: National Television System Committee) analog terrestrial broadcasting, 525 scanning lines are used in video signals, and in the 525 lines, each field (field) (consisting of two fields) The first 21 entries of 1 frame) are allocated to an interval (interval) for starting scanning called VBI (Vertical Blanking Interval: Vertical Blanking Interval). Closed captions are transmitted by multiplexing character codes on entry 21 of the VBI for each field. Then, about 60 characters per second are transmitted for 2 kinds of character groups using each field. the

此外,关于数字电视广播的字幕信息的传输构成为,如国内规定即地面数字电视广播运用规定、技术资料(ARIB TR-B14)、BS/宽带CS数字广播运用规定、技术资料(ARIB TR-B15)中规定,使用字幕信息用的传输流,能够与视频信息的传输同时传输字幕信息。然后,在数字电视广播用接收机中,对与字幕信息对应的码进行解码,并生成构成字幕的字符、图形,从而将其 叠加在视频上进行显示。在数字电视广播中有如下的技术:将使用字幕信息用的传输流与视频信息的传输同时传输的文本信息保存在内部,通过电视监视器任意时刻都能够显示阅览在内部保存的文本信息,从而即使用户不取被显示的字幕的记录,也能够灵活应用字幕的信息。(例如,参照专利文献1)。  In addition, the transmission of subtitle information on digital TV broadcasting consists of, for example, domestic regulations, namely, terrestrial digital TV broadcasting operating regulations, technical documents (ARIB TR-B14), BS/broadband CS digital broadcasting operating regulations, technical documents (ARIB TR-B15 ) stipulates that subtitle information can be transmitted simultaneously with the transmission of video information by using a transport stream for subtitle information. Then, in a receiver for digital television broadcasting, codes corresponding to subtitle information are decoded to generate characters and graphics constituting subtitles, which are superimposed on the video and displayed. In digital television broadcasting, there is a technique of internally storing text information transmitted simultaneously with transmission of video information using a transport stream for subtitle information, and displaying and viewing the internally stored text information at any time on a TV monitor, thereby Even if the user does not take a record of the displayed subtitles, it is possible to utilize the information of the subtitles. (For example, refer to Patent Document 1). the

接着,参照图6,说明图1所示的接收装置23中的内容阅览功能。图6是表示图1所示的接收装置23中的内容阅览功能的图。接收装置23具有元数据(metadata)检索功能、阅读模式功能以及观看模式功能三个功能。  Next, referring to FIG. 6, the content browsing function in the receiving device 23 shown in FIG. 1 will be described. FIG. 6 is a diagram showing a content browsing function in the receiving device 23 shown in FIG. 1 . The receiving device 23 has three functions of a metadata search function, a reading mode function, and a viewing mode function. the

(1)元数据检索功能  (1) Metadata retrieval function

通过关键字的输入,能够精确地(pin point)到达节目内想观看的地方 的功能。元数据是利用字幕数据而生成的,并作为文本来提供。  Through the input of keywords, it is possible to precisely (pin point) the function of reaching the place you want to watch in the program. Metadata is generated using subtitle data and provided as text. the

例如,作为检索关键字输入“ていえん(庭院)”,则彻底检索全节目的元数据,能够检索到“日本的庭院”的节目内的场景。  For example, if "ていえん (garden)" is entered as a search keyword, the metadata of the entire program can be searched thoroughly, and scenes in the program "Garden in Japan" can be searched. the

(2)阅读模式功能  (2) Reading mode function

是通过将文本(字幕数据)和静止图像(缩略图)相关联显示,可迅速阅览信息的功能,能够进行滚动和换页。由于事先下载了文本和静止图像,因此即使在电波不能到达的地方也“何时何地都”可进行阅览。  It is a function for quickly viewing information by displaying text (caption data) and still images (thumbnails) in association, and scrolling and page switching are possible. Since the text and still images are downloaded in advance, it can be viewed "anytime, anywhere" even in places where radio waves cannot reach. the

(3)观看模式功能  (3) Watch mode function

是若在观看模式功能下点击文本部分,则可再现该时间点开始的活动图像的功能,具有快进/倒退/搜索功能。活动图像再现包括用于再现预先在接收装置23内存储的视频内容的功能、通过通信或广播由数据流进行再现的功能。由数据流进行再现的情况下,可长时间进行活动图像再现,且存储中断了视听的地方,可简单地再次开始视听。  It is a function that if you click a text part in the viewing mode function, the moving image starting at that point in time can be reproduced, and it has fast forward/rewind/search functions. Movie reproduction includes a function for reproducing video content previously stored in the receiving device 23, and a function for reproducing data streams through communication or broadcasting. In the case of playback by data stream, moving image playback can be performed for a long time, and the point where viewing was interrupted is stored, and viewing can be resumed easily. the

阅读模式和观看模式可联动地进行切换,能够将阅读模式用于检索想观看的活动图像。  The reading mode and viewing mode can be switched in conjunction, and the reading mode can be used to search for a moving image to be viewed. the
